The "plating repair tool" has been added to the game in the form of a
printable upgrade for janiborgs. It's a subtype of the cautery that can
repair burnt or damaged hull platings, allowing floor tiles to be
placed over them once again.
The upgrade that adds it to a janiborg's list of tools can be printed
once the Cyborg Upgrades: Utility tech node is researched.
Janiborgs get floor tiles (and a crowbar), but have no way of dealing
with burnt platings. Thus, what ends up happening is that, after fixing
some flooring after a minor explosion, you'll often be left with one or
two ugly, OCD-triggering untiled spots on the floor that you can't put
a floor tile over because you don't have a welder. What makes these
spots even more infuriating is that it would actually be BETTER if they
had been broken down to just being space-exposed rods, because then you
COULD place a floor tile on their tile.

This PR adds the crystal invasion event, a new event involving the Supermatter and the monsters from within.
When the event starts there will be a message from centcomm announcing it, then the supermatter explode leaving a destabilized crystal that emits radiations and harmful gases; after a bit portals will spawn around the station, that will produce a number of monsters each. there are 4 types of waves and 4 types of portals
The waves are: Small, Medium, Big, Huge (each have different kind of portals that can spawn and different amounts too)
The portals are the same types of the waves, they differ from each other for the number of monsters that can spawn and the kind of monsters that can spawn (bigger portals spawn stronger monsters)
To end the event the players should stabilize the crystal by destroying the portals (for now are indestructible and they are disabled by using an anomaly neutralizer, might change that) and collecting otherworld crystals; then those crystals are to be put in the crystal stabilizer, an item unlockable in the tech tree. After this just inject the destabilized crystal with it and the remaining portals will close on their own (the spawned monsters will still remain tho so you have to slay them)
All the numbers are mostly eyeballed and could change if requested/with feedbacks

Alright, from the top:
Sinks now need plumbing to pump out liquids.
All sinks now has a demand-only plumbing pipe face the opposite direction of the sink itself. A standard iron sink will hold 100 units of water, and must be constructed from a sink frame. To complete the frame, a new stock part, the water recycler must be applied to the frame. Once the sink is constructed, it will only hold those 100 units of water until new water is piped in.
This however doesn't extend just to water, as a result. Any reagent can be piped into the sink, and will be used 5 units at a time per use. This means water isn't just an infinite resource, and will need to be resupplied to the station if, somehow, you're using a metric ton of water somehow.
image
A basic sink setup with water being plumbed in.
Showers now need plumbing to wash you off.
Want to dispense reagents faster on your Patients Victims Friends Coworkers? Well, you may also construct a shower frame, in a similar fashion to a sink frame, and pipe in your own reagents into the loop. The shower drains reagents much faster than the shower, and also preforms vapor and touch reagent reactions, resulting in a constant stream of chemicals being processed. This can lead to horrible situations, like a chemical heater hooked up to a vat of cooking oil being pumped into a shower.
Additionally, showers will display the reagents they're pumping out visually based on the color of their chemical contents. As a result, dangerous or unique showers are going to look noticeably different if their contents are dangerous looking.

So, reagent dispensers, like water/fuel tanks, Virus Food, Cooking Oil Vats, Pepperspray, and the like, can now be converted into a stationary tank of reagents by using a sheet of metal on it, allowing it to behave as a simple supply of their respective contents, and can be pumped into a plumbing network. This means rolling water tanks can be used to resupply sinks and showers, as well as allow for inventive uses of otherwise unused chemicals located all around the station. Pump welding fuel into a resupply line to fight a blob! Pump pepper spray into the dorms showers! Create a deep fryer shower! The possibilities are LIMITED (Because we have very few reagent dispensers)! Still, this will prevent sinks and showers from being completely unfix-able should all the water run out, as cargo can purchase many of these chemical tanks at will.

By clicking yourself with grab intent while targeting a limb of yours that's bleeding, you'll "grab" onto it with your free hand to apply pressure. This takes 1.5 seconds to do, takes up a hand while you do so, and applies a slowdown while you're holding it. In return, that limb will bleed 30% less while you're holding it (though it won't clot any faster). This stacks with the 25% reduction in bleeding you get from being horizontal, so laying down clutching your gushing gut while waiting for help is now both thematic and viable!
